The photographer and visual artist is announced as the luxury watchmaker’s first Chinese female brand ambassador

The inimitable Chen Man, visual artist and striking style icon, has been announced as Hublot’s first-ever Chinese female brand ambassador. Chen is widely known for her photography – a visual style that is as high fashion as her own personal look – and the alignment between herself and the luxury watch brand is based on their shared appreciation for the artful side of life.

Chen also previously shot three other Hublot ambassadors – supermodel Bar Rafaeli, pianist Lang Lang, and Italian entrepreneur Lapo Erkann. And now it’s her time in front of the camera.

On her appointment, Chen said: “I’m proud to be the brand ambassador of Hublot. I love the brand, not only out of its respect for watchmaking traditions and persistence in innovation, but also because the brand’s spirit coincides perfectly with mine. The power of fusion brings greater tension into art pieces and increases the depth of thinking. The brand philosophy of Hublot keeps me exploring, realising my dream of art.”

The partnership is just one of the many that form the Hublot Loves Art initiative, connecting luxury with culture.
